Jean Carzou
Jean Carzou , of his true name Karnik Zouloumian is a painter, engraver and Décorateur French of origin Arménie nne, born with Alep (Syria) on January 1st 1907 and died in Périgueux (the Dordogne) the August 12th 2000.
Biography
He studies initially at the Pères Marists. In 1924, its brilliances school results at the Kaloustian school of the Cairo (Egypt) are worth a purse of the Armenian community to him.After a long career of painter, engraver and decorator of Theater, it had launched out, old already 83 years, in gigantic a Apocalypse of which it had countered the walls of the church of the Presentation Manosque (Alp-of-High-Provence). Not the literal illustration of the Apocalypse of Midsummer's Day, but “climate of our populated time” of devastated horizons, embrumés ships, tangled up rails and blockhouse translating its obsession of the war and the Holocaust. It in particular carried out there a superb portrait of woman-tree to the face of Madone, delivering in the world a message of eternal humanity.
It joined Paris for studies of Architecture. With the approach of the Years 1930, it “makes rounds, squares” with Montparnasse. It lives sparely thanks to its caricatures of politicians published in the press and in its drawings on fabrics. It paints “far from the schools”, making the experiment necessary to the result of its characters of “painter-craftsman” as it is named.
Since 1939, it organized more than one hundred particular exposures of its works in Paris, in province and abroad. It also takes part in several official exposures organized by France out of Europe, and receives prestigious Prix Hallmark with three recoveries (in 1949,1952 and 1955).
Carzou is not satisfied to paint blue and singular fabrics. It enchases its tables and its watercolours in medallions of velvet or papers notched. To some critic art which describe it as “decorator”, it launches “you will have painting but also theater”. In 1952, its realization of the decoration and costumes for the act of Incas of the the gallant Indies of Jean-Philippe Rameau with the national Opéra of Paris reveals it with the general public. It connects with the Wolf (1953) for the Ballets of Roland Petit. Gisele (1954) and Athalie (1955) charms the spectators of the Opera and the Comédie-Française.
In 1977, Carzou draws itself its sword of academician before making his entry with the Institut of the Art schools. Destroyer of the laxism of the modern society in general, and the cubism in particular, it estimates that Picasso is “a personality which does not make painting”. Only Claude Lorrain, Watteau and Dali is, according to him, “of great painters”. He buys also works of his colleagues figurative painters, and in particular of Maurice Boitel with the gallery Drouet, Faubourg Saint-Honore, with the beginning of the year 1980.
Author of an important lithographic work and illustration ( the Illuminations of Rimbaud) and tapestries, decorator of vault of the church of the convent of Manosque become Foundation Carzou in 1991, the artist saw his work devoted in 1986, with Vence (the Alpes-Maritimes), with the opening of a museum to his name, but which will be closed a few years later.
Father of the realizer and writer Jean-Marie Carzou, grandfather of the writer and journalist Louis Carzou, Jean Carzou was widowed of Nane (Jeanne Gabrielle Blanc), deceased in March 1998.
He was Officier of the Légion of honor, Commandeur of the National order of the Merit and Commandeur of the Ordre of Arts and the Letters.
He is deceased on August 12th, 2000 with Périgueux, at the 93 years age, after having acquired an international repute. The France, the Great Britain, the the United States, the Egypt, the Japan accommodated several of its exposures of inks, pencils, gouaches or strange pastels.
